The ANA IORGA FW22 Florii collection is inspired by the techniques used in traditional Romanian clothing as well as the freedom brought by the Romanian revolution, this collection explores my heritage and values through 5 couture pieces.
PIECE #1
The first piece of the collection features a long sleeve midi length gown constructed with embroidered tulle, a lace in corset with boning and underwire, and over 40 yards of tulle as well as a crinoline to create the full skirt. The design was inspired by traditional Romanian costumes in the silhouette as well as floral embroidery style. The corset was constructed using custom couture techniques and the whole dress was finished with silk satin binding on the hems and seams.
TRADITION
This collection brings to light the beautiful and intricate elements of the ages old Romanian culture. A part of my heritage, the collection draws elements from traditional Romanian costumes, namely the intricate embroidery, colours and silhouettes.
FREEDOM
The collection also draws on the concept of freedom and the 1989 Romanian communist revolution, a huge impact on modern society in the country. It brings to light that freedom is our fundamental right and that we constantly need to fight for it.
FLORII
This Fall / Winter 2022
couture collection is named FLORII, the Romanian word for flowers. Flowers have long been a symbol of peace and freedom, as well as an integral part of the Romanian folklore symbols and clothing,
PIECE #2
The second piece of the collection features a sleeveless long gown constructed with embroidered lace, a lace in corset with boning and underwire, and over 20 yards of tulle as well as a crinoline to create the draping skirt with train. The corset and bodysuit was constructed using custom couture techniques and the whole dress was finished with silk satin binding on the hems and seams. The dress also features a convertible hood that can be worn up as a veil or down as a bolero. The design was inspired by modern interpretations of wedding dresses, as well as keeping in line with the liberating theme of the collection.

PIECE #4
The fourth piece of the collection features a long sleeve fitted gown with a mesh corset bodysuit with boning and underwire, and an invisible zip closure. The design was inspired by traditional Romanian costumes in the silhouette as well as floral embroidery style. The corset was constructed using custom couture techniques and the whole dress was finished with silk satin binding on the hems and seams. The dress is also adorned with 3D printed handmade flowers.
PIECE #5
The fifth piece of the collection features a strapless wedding dress, as in the couture tradition of the finale. The piece is convertible from a traditional white wedding gown to a black one, symbolizing the uprise of revolution and freedom.
It is constructed using embroidered lace and an underwire boned corset, lace up closure and the black convertible mesh is hidden in an off shoulder panel that is pulled out to reveal the second side of the dress.
